Abstract
The oxidation resistance of SiC-BN composites with different BN content hot-pressed from Si3N4, B4C and C was investigated. The oxidized products of SiC and BN were identified to be SiO2, C and B2O3, N2. SiO2 and B2O3 could further form a borosilicate glass which covered the surfaces of the samples and withstood oxidation because of its flowability and self-healing. The oxidation resistance of the SiC-BN composites in static air atmosphere deteriorated with the increase of temperature as well as of the BN content.
